Campus IT does not want another siloed password list. Gearlog accepts standard OIDC for SSO and SCIM 2.0 for provisioning, with group-to-role mapping for staff access.

Campus IT does not want another password list

Media programs still need desk access controls, but directory teams want login and lifecycle in the IdP. Identity features exist so gear-room ops and campus IT can meet in the middle—on Institution plans.

OIDC single sign-on

Configure your OIDC provider from Settings → Identity—issuer, client credentials, endpoints, scopes, group claim, and email domains. Compatible with common campus IdPs such as Entra ID, Okta, and Google Workspace.

  • Workspace-scoped OIDC configuration
  • Works with common campus IdPs
  • Email domain and group claim controls

SCIM 2.0 lifecycle

SCIM Users and Groups support create, update, and deactivate with org bearer tokens. Provisioning covers day-to-day lifecycle; bulk SCIM operations are not offered.

  • Create, update, and deactivate via SCIM
  • Org bearer token authentication
  • Day-to-day provisioning, not bulk SCIM ops

Group to role mapping

Map IdP groups to Gearlog roles (super admin through borrower) so media desks and AV cages stay permissioned correctly while inventory stays workspace-scoped.

Workspace-scoped inventory still holds

SSO does not flatten every room into one pile of gear. Identity controls who can sign in and which role they receive; workspaces still scope inventory and checkouts.
